Day 1: Marrakech » Ait Ben Haddou Kasbah » Dades Valley [315 Km]

Your shared Marrakech To Fes desert trip will start in the morning with pick up from your hotel or the nearest accessible point to your riad. After driving past Marrakech suburbs, full of small towns, and different farms, we start driving uphill to cross the High Atlas Mountains. A quick stop for a coffee and toilet will be made before we reach the famous Tizi Ntichka pass ( 2260 m high ).
Numerous stops will be made to take photos and stretch your legs before the landscape dramatically changes upon approaching Kasbah Air Ben Hadou. This UNESCO classified village is one of the most visited landmarks in Morocco. It is famous for having been -and still is- used for different Hollywood epics ( Game of thrones, Kingdom of heaven, Gladiator, etc…. )
If you wish, you can hire a local guide with the rest of the group ( optional ) for a visit of the village before you choose a local cafe for lunch.
In the afternoon, we continue to Dades Valley past Ouarzazate, Skoura oasis and Klaa Mgrouna, the latter is famous for its Damascus rose plantation and distillation. The journey between Ouarzazate and Dades is also known as ‘’ The road of 1001 Kasbahs’’
Upon arrival at Boumalne Dades, deviate to a minor road driving past amazing scenery of Dades River, with different fortified Berber villages in the backdrop.
Arrive at your Dads Hotel just before it gets dark, and enjoy your dinner.

Day 2: Dades » Todra Gorges » Erfoud » Merzouga [255 km]

After having enjoyed your breakfast, get ready for an amazing journey which will be the highlight of your shared Marrakech to Fez desert tour: Your next stop will be at Tinghir oasis, where you will have the chance of walking along the stream under the shade of date palm and olive trees witnessing local Berbers taking care of their crops or herding their cattle.
The walk will lead you to the majestic cliffs of Todgha Gorges where you will have the opportunity to take some photos and enjoy the silence.
After lunch at leisure at one of the local cafes, you will continue to Rissani past various small towns, oases, and Ksours ( fortified villages ). From here, you can spot the pink sand dunes approaching over the horizon. Upon arrival in Merzouga, meet your camel caravan, and start an hour-long camel ride over Erg Chebbi sand dunes marveling at one of the best sunset views.
Continue your camel trek to your Sahara desert camp. A delicious Moroccan dinner will be served tonight at your Bedouin camp, and your nomad hosts will be entertaining you around the campfire with their drums under the crystal clear sky.
Overnight at your Merzouga desert camp.

Day 3: Merzouga Desert » Ziz Valley » Midelt » Ifrane » Fes [467 Km]

You will wake up in time to watch the sun rise over the 300-meter-tall dunes and travel into the dawn towards the border with Algeria. Next, you will return by camel to a hotel for breakfast and a shower. You will then depart for Fes, traveling through the Ziz valley and stopping for lunch in village with plentiful apple orchards. You will later enjoy the journey through mountain cedar forests before arriving to Fes in the afternoon, stopping to take pictures at a panoramic viewpoint.

Your estimated time of arrival to Fes is 17h00, and your shared 3 days desert tour from Marrakech to Fes will come to an end with a drop off at your hotel or the nearest accessible point to your Road.
